Florida State's head football, Willie Taggart has been fired after less than 2 years of coaching. The Seminoles record while Taggart was head coach is 9-12. Last year was the first year they had missed a bowl game since 1981. The Seminoles have to win 2 of their next 3 games to be eligable to go to a bowl game. Now Florida State has to find a new head coach before their next game on November 9. Click here to read more about this.
